Recent Breakthrough Research (2025)
- Comorbidity Analysis and Clustering of Endometriosis Patients Using Electronic Health Records (Khan et al., 2025)
- Study Design: Retrospective case-control study using electronic health records
- Population: >43,500 endometriosis patients across six UC medical centers
- Key Findings:
- 661 significantly enriched conditions identified at UCSF
- 302 conditions replicated across independent datasets (45% validation rate)
- Strongest associations: Uterine adenomyosis (OR = 181), pelvic adhesions (OR = 51.1)
- Protective effects: Hyperlipidemia (OR = 0.67) - potential statin therapy benefits
- Patient clustering: Distinct subgroups with different comorbidity patterns
- Clinical Impact: Confirms endometriosis as multi-system disorder requiring personalized treatment approaches
- Data Source: De-identified EHRs using OMOP Common Data Model with cross-dataset validation

Active Clinical Studies:
- Celmatix
- Pioneering the first non-hormonal, disease-modifying approach to treating endometriosis that both directly addresses pain mechanisms and resets innate immune cells to cause regression of endometriotic lesions.
- Gesynta Pharma
- Vipoglanstat to enter clinical phase II development targeting endometriosis. Gesynta Pharma’s targeted approach to the enzyme mPGES-1 provides more precise treatments for inflammation and pain.
- RPN-002 (nolasiban): A molecular entity to manage adenomyosis
- Lead clinical compound, RPN-001 (leflutrozole), is being developed to treat male infertility. RPN-002 (nolasiban) is a first-in-disease and first-in-class molecular entity to manage adenomyosis and increase the probability of embryo implantation in women undergoing assisted reproductive technology (ART) treatments.
- Serac: New Diagnostic Imaging Potential for Endometriosis
- A Phase II clinical study has indicated that 99mTc-maraciclatide is capable of imaging superficial peritoneal endometriosis – the earliest stage of the disease which is not well-visualised with current imaging tools – and plans for a Phase III study in this indication are underway.
- TiumBio
- Conducting a Phase 2a clinical trial of TU2670 in endometriosis in 5 European countries. TU2670 is an oral GnRH antagonist that can bind to pituitary receptors to suppress estradiol hormone.
Potential Causes
- Fusobacterium Infection
- Researchers in Japan have identified a particular kind of bacteria in those with endometriosis by examining the microbes inhabiting the endometrium. Of 155 patients with endometriosis, 64% had a Fusobacterium infection. Only 7% of patients without endometriosis carried the bacteria. Further research showed that by introducing the infection to mice to replicate the disease, the infection can be treated with cheap and widely available antibiotics. With evidence that Fusobacterium may contribute to the growth of endometriosis, further research will be conducted in humans on the potential of antibiotics as a treatment.
